Licensees getting set to benefit from film's storming performance at the box office.
20th Century Fox blockbuster Avatar has stormed through the $1 billion ticket sales barrier, joining an elite group of just four other films.
BBC News reported that the James Cameron-directed movie has earned more than $350 million in the US and over $670 million in the rest of the world in just 17 days.
It joins Titanic, The Lord of the Rings: The Return of the King,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Man's Chest and The Dark Knight in the $1bn+ gang.
Fox distribution executive Bert Livingston was quoted on BBC News Online as saying: "This is like a freight train out of control - it just keeps going. I think everybody has to see Avatar once."
The licensing programme accompanying the movie has also been steadily gaining momentum. Over 125 products across the toy, video game, apparel and publishing sectors have been secured.
